Camille Pissarro

1830-1903

Camille Pissarro, a key figure in the Impressionist movement, is celebrated for his innovative approach to capturing the fleeting effects of light and the rhythms of everyday life. His works, characterized by their vibrant colors and dynamic compositions, offer a unique and enduring perspective on the beauty and complexity of the modern urban landscape.
